Although classic Emergency Vehicles have featured at the Gloucestershire Steam Extravaganza previously, 2012 will see the formation of the specific Emergency Vehicle section here at South Cerney.
As with anything new, its difficult to really say what to expect but if the enthusiasm and interest displayed thus far is anything to go by, the endeavour will be a huge success.
The aim is to gather a selection of ex Emergency Vehicles together and present a display that encompasses all of the three main services of Fire, Police and Ambulance plus some of the other emergency services like the RNLI, Coastguard and such like. The section will not only be static either, as we are utilising several of the Fire appliances to carry water around the site and service some of the more remote Steam Engines.
The importance of having these vehicles on site can't be emphasised either, as in 2011 several of the Fire Engines in the Commercial Vehicle section were called upon to put out a small grass fire in the Steam Play Pen ! This in itself created a fascinating and unique display, although we do not intend to repeat it in 2012!
